Post

Starting Packapun: A Journey Through Software Engineering

Starting Packapun: A Journey Through Software Engineering

In June 2025, I wanted to start sharing what I learned throughout my career in technology as I navigated challenging situations and how I made sure to keep the spark alive by thinking longer term.

The Evolution of a Software Engineer

“The best way to predict the future is to implement it.” - Alan Kay

The Early Days

My journey in software engineering began with the fundamental building blocks:

  • Problem Solving: Breaking down complex challenges into manageable pieces
  • Code Quality: Writing clean, maintainable, and efficient code
  • Collaboration: Working effectively in teams and contributing to shared goals

Key Lessons Learned

  1. Technical Growth
    • Never stop learning new technologies
    • Master the fundamentals before diving into frameworks
    • Understand both the “how” and the “why” of your solutions
  2. Soft Skills
    • Communication is as important as coding
    • Empathy in code reviews and team interactions
    • Time management and prioritization
  3. Career Development
    • Building a strong professional network
    • Contributing to open source projects
    • Mentoring others and being mentored

The Long-Term Perspective

Why It Matters

In the fast-paced world of technology, it’s easy to get caught up in:

  • 🔥 Latest frameworks and tools
  • 🚀 Quick wins and immediate results
  • 📈 Short-term metrics and KPIs

However, the most successful engineers I’ve met focus on:

  • 🌱 Sustainable growth
  • 🏗️ Building solid foundations
  • 🤝 Creating lasting impact

Staying Relevant

Skill AreaShort-term FocusLong-term Strategy
TechnicalLatest frameworksCore principles
Soft SkillsImmediate communicationRelationship building
CareerCurrent roleIndustry trends

Looking Forward

As I continue this journey, I’ll be sharing:

  • Detailed technical deep-dives
  • Career development strategies
  • Team leadership insights
  • Personal growth experiences

Stay tuned for more content that combines technical expertise with practical wisdom gained from years in the industry.


“The best time to plant a tree was 20 years ago. The second best time is now.” - Chinese Proverb

This post is licensed under CC BY 4.0 by the author.